Study on the anti-inflammatory active components and mechanism of Polygonati-rhizoma based on network pharmacologyChinese Full Text
XU Hui;DAI Lei;DENG Pengfei;XU Xiaoniu;School of Forestry and Landscape Architecture, Anhui Agricultural University;
Abstract: Polygonati rhizoma has important medicinal and edible values, tastes sweet and refreshing. To explore the possible anti-inflammatory active components and mechanism of Polygonati rhizoma, the active components in Polygonati rhizoma were screened by TCMSP database; the target genes related to Polygonati rhizoma active components were found in Pharmmapper and Uni Prot database, human inflammatory related genes were screened using GeneCards and Malacards databases, and the potential anti-inflammatory targets of Polygonati rhizoma were obtained by intersection; GO enrichment and KEGG pathway annotation were carried out by Metascape database; the "Compound-Target-Disease" network diagram of potential anti-inflammatory targets of Polygonati rhizoma was constructed by using Cytoscape3.6.1 software, and PPI network diagram was constructed by using string database. A total of 12 potential active components, including(+)-Syringaresinol-O-beta-D-glucoside, zhonghualiaoine 1, Diosgenin, 3’-Methoxydaidzein, Beta-Sitosterol, Methylprotodioscin and 65 potential anti-inflammatory targets of Polygonati rhizoma, such as ALB, EGFR, MAPK1, CASP3, ESR1, etc., were screened out, and 46 GO items and 13 KEGG items were screened out in bioinformatics enrichment analysis. The pathways mainly involve in cancer, prostate cancer, IL-17 signaling pathway and hepatitis B. The study reveals the mechanism of anti-inflammatory multi-component, multi-target and multi-channel of Polygonati rhizoma, which provides a basis for the research of anti-inflammatory mechanism of Polygonati rhizoma and the subsequent experimental research.
